Electrical - k3 - headlight and rear light dim when indicators on.
 
Hi all,

I have an electrical problem with a k3. I have read numerous posts on this and other forums but don't know where to start.

When indicators flash both the headlights and rear lights dim intermittently, I.e indicate flash, lights dim, indicator off, lights back on.

I first thought it was just the rear light as I have read they can fail and the top LEDs are dimmer than the rest however if I unplug the rear light the headlights still are affected.

Everything I'm reading says earth problem but how do I fix this?

I've had no starting problems and it's done this for a while now, perhaps even since I owned the bike. It doesn't seem to be causing other problems but it will fail an mot.

Re: Electrical - k3 - headlight and rear light dim when indicators on.
 
Is that on idle or switched off? the lights will dim a little if the indicators are used as they are using power. Rev the bike to 2-3k and see if it does the same thing.

Re: Electrical - k3 - headlight and rear light dim when indicators on.
 
Mine does the exact same thing, has done for 4 years, when there is any revs on it won't do it however. its only logical really, if you add more things onto an electrical circuit the rest will dim down.

The issue should however disappear if its at 3K. there should be more than enough coming from the charging circuit to even it out. I am going to the garage to try mine. shall get back to you in a couple mins
